Output 66b882f944ddf8daf29b34fca377536d3576b86a8b1d8ae8e6fb22c02b04ea07:1

value
40756581
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43b90f845e576e4597d126cb40148d6b06dfe642 OP_EQUALVERIFY OP_CHECKSIG
address
17B5y6C2t28R2ZzgK6DWkVjYv9TWekiz2B
transaction
66b882f944ddf8daf29b34fca377536d3576b86a8b1d8ae8e6fb22c02b04ea07
confirmations
405764
spent
true